Reddit user AquaGleebis created some Persona 5 themed poker chip designs, which look straight out of a limited edition set in terms of detail and adherence to the thematic designs of Persona 5.

Persona 5 Poker Chip reddit Atlus The Royal

AquaGleebis made two separate chips, the first which is a more simplistic one decorated with the P5 letter logo and distinctive Phantom Thieves logo. According to their post, they weren't satisfied with that version so they set out to make a new, more detailed.

The second chip design features every Phantom Thief members' mask with their logo in the center. My favorite part of this chip is the interweaving of Arsene's, the protagonist's first and signature Persona, chains throughout the chip.

Recently new information has been revealed concerning a possible new version of the title called Persona 5 The Royal on March 23rd in a teaser trailer. The trailer debuted at the end of the anime's final episode "Stars and Ours," which was livestreamed on Japanese television, and featured a mysterious young woman who was critical of the Phantom Thieves and their methods.
